Depsgraph: Implement builder from given set of IDs
The title explains it all actually: this commit introduces special dependency graph builder API which builds graph which is sufficient to evaluate given set of IDs.

+/* Optimized builders for dependency graph built from a given set of IDs.
+ *
+ * General notes:
+ *
+ * - We pull in all bases if their objects are in the set of IDs. This allows to have proper
+ * visibility and other flags assigned to the objects.
+ * All other bases (the ones which points to object which is outside of the set of IDs) are
+ * completely ignored.
+ *
+ * - Proxy groups pointing to objects which are outside of the IDs set are also ignored.
+ * This way we avoid high-poly character body pulled into the dependency graph when it's coming
+ * from a library into an animation file and the dependency graph constructed for a proxy rig. */
